Welcome to AMU
Adam Mickiewicz University is the major academic institution in Poznań and one of the top Polish universities. Its reputation is founded on tradition, the outstanding achievements of the faculty and the attractive curriculum. The mission of the University is to advance knowledge through high quality research and teaching in partnership with business, professions, public services and other research and learning providers.

The University
It is a centre of academic excellence where research and teaching are mutually sustaining, and where the context within which research is conducted and knowledge is sought and applied is international as much as regional and national. The University continuously extends and updates research programs and contents of study curricula, with a special emphasis on their interdisciplinary and international nature. 613 projects are currently being carried out by international and national research teams.

Study at AMU
The University is organized into 20 Faculties where mostly training-through-research is offered together with high quality supervision according to the HRS4R policy adopted at AMU. Each fellow may take advantage of the supervisor’s experience or contacts. AMU has received the "HR Excellence in Research" award and has implemented the principles of the European Charter for Researchers and the Code of Conduct for the Recruitment of Researchers.
